Output 789664fe17e897e2f265e3f9376e54ccfb6a4f0734749e19d5947c7e99b725fa:30

value
5866
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 568d5b29bcacdfc09e066266296c54be01985b180a3d8674f564bd9ad65c4838
address
bc1p26x4k2du4n0up8sxvfnzjmz5hcqeskccpg7cva84vj7e44jufquqtlqu0x
transaction
789664fe17e897e2f265e3f9376e54ccfb6a4f0734749e19d5947c7e99b725fa
spent
true